Principal Display Panel (2 mg/0.5 mg Tablet Bottle Label)

Principal Display Panel (2 mg/0.5 mg Tablet Bottle Label)
Label for Buprenorphine and Naloxone Sublingual Tablets, USP 2 mg/0.5 mg by Redpharm Drug. The label includes instructions for pharmacists to dispense the Medication Guide, warnings about accidental ingestion by children, and storage conditions at 20 to 25°C. The package contains 30 tablets for sublingual use, with dosage details and NDC 42858-601-03.*

Principal Display Panel (8 mg/2 mg Tablet Bottle Label)

Principal Display Panel (8 mg/2 mg Tablet Bottle Label)
Label for Buprenorphine and Naloxone Sublingual Tablets, USP, 8 mg/2 mg strength, by Redpharm Drug. The label indicates the tablets are prescription-only, with a pack size of 30 tablets. Storage instructions recommend room temperature, 20° to 25°C (68° to 77°F). Additional details include a pharmacist dispensing note, warnings for accidental ingestion, and a barcode. The label also notes controlled substance information and manufacturer details.*
